Life is Strange Remastered Gets New Release Date
Square Enix announced that the Deck Nine Games and DontNod-developed adventure collection, Life is Strange Remastered, will launch on PlayStation 4,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ch, and PC on February 1, 2022. This is following a recent delay.
Life is Strange Remastered bundles up Life is Strange and Life is Strange 2 with a few updated features to make it a “remastered” title. The absence of current-gen consoles is strange, but the game will be playable via backward compatibility.
Life is Strange Remastered includes some quality-of-life enhancement such as remastered characters and environment visuals. Further, the game is running on a new engine, which allowed the team to utilize better lighting and textures. The original game has also received a facelift with new fully motion-captured facial animation, and the sequel includes new outfits and a Farewell episode.
The collection tells the full story of Max and Chloe through some of the most significant parts of their lives. They suffer some rather intense situations, but the over-dramatized scenes make for a decent adventure experience that has gained many fans.
